Fees

Verify the accreditation of any lawyer you employ to represent your VA disability claim. To be an accredited representative, the attorney must meet certain standards, such as having experience in the field and training in the field of veterans law. Additionally, they are not allowed to charge more than 20% of past due benefits to represent you before the VA. Any cost that is higher than this must be substantiated by clear and convincing proof that it isn't reasonable.

A skilled VA disability lawyer will know how difficult it can be to apply for and get the benefits you are entitled to. They will handle your case on your behalf and challenge any VA officials who may have abused or mistreated you.

Your lawyer for veterans disability can help you understand all benefits you can get regardless of whether you're in the beginning of your claim or an appeal. This includes supplemental benefits such as the allowance for automobiles, educational assistance and service-disabled veteran insurance, as well as medical coverage.

In addition to the fees imposed by attorneys in addition to the legal fees, there are additional costs incurred by the process of claiming, such as hiring independent experts to analyze your medical and vocational evidence. The good news is that under the Equal Access to Justice Act the expenses will be reimbursed by the VA after your appeal is granted.

Appeals

An attorney can assist you in filing an appeal when the VA denies you disability benefits or awards you a lower rating that is not fair. There are many ways to appeal a decision and each one takes a different time. An attorney can explain the process to you in plain language and help you choose the method that is most appropriate for your circumstances.

The easiest way to appeal an award is to ask an experienced claims adjudicator to review the decision. This lane requires a thorough review of the existing evidence in your claim, and you cannot submit any new evidence.

You can also submit an additional claim if you have evidence that is new and relevant to back up your claim. This section lets you provide any evidence that is not medical and was not part of your original application. This includes lay statements, which are sworn statements from people who are aware of how your condition affects them.

In the end, you can request direct review from the Board of Veterans' Appeals in Washington, D.C. This lane has the greatest chance of success, but it's the most complex and lengthy option.
